Get That Chiseled Look With Dermal Filler

Dermal fillers and injectables are one of the fastest, most effective ways to restore lost volume, reinforce structure, and improve how you show up in the mirror.

They’re ideal for sculpting the jawline and chin, smoothing deep folds, or filling in hollow areas like the temples and under-eyes. Results are immediate, subtle and long-lasting — often up to a year or more depending on the product.

At The Lads Room, we tailor our injection techniques to male-specific goals — using deeper placement, straighter lines, and wider distribution. The goal: a chiseled look that’s still natural and true to you.

Men's Dermal Filler FAQ's

What is the filler treatment like?

Before we inject, we’ll numb the area so you’re comfortable throughout. Most fillers also contain lidocaine, a local anesthetic that keeps things easy. The whole process is quick and straightforward.

How many dermal filler sessions do I need?

It depends on your goals and how much volume or structure we’re working with. Some male patients get the result they want in one session. Others need a few rounds for a more layered, natural build.

What can I expect after a dermal filler treatment?

You might notice a bit of swelling, bruising, or tenderness at the injection sites. Some areas swell more than others. Jawline and chin usually stay pretty low-key. Results show up instantly and last for 12 to 24 months depending on the product.

What is the aftercare for fillers like Juvederm and Restylane?

Rest assured that your injector will provide full instructions for aftercare, but here are the main things to keep in mind:

  • Don’t touch the area for at least 6 hours.

  • No skincare products, makeup, or lip balm until the next day.

  • Ice packs (wrapped in a clean towel) help with swelling.

  • Skip the gym or sauna for 24 hours.

  • Avoid dental work and laser treatments near the injected area for 1–2 weeks.

  • Don’t use suction devices or apply pressure to the area.

  • Mild soreness is normal—Tylenol is fine, but skip Advil and other NSAIDs for a couple of days to reduce bruising risk.

  • Sleep slightly elevated the first night to help swelling go down.
What’s the difference between male and female filler treatments?

Filler goals and techniques vary significantly. Men typically want stronger angles and definition that don’t soften their features, especially in the jawline, chin, and cheeks. That means straighter lines, deeper placement, and volume in just the right places.
Women benefit from softer curves, lifted cheeks, or lip volume. That’s why working with an injector trained in male anatomy matters if you want a natural but more masculine look.

Who can NOT have dermal fillers?

Anyone with active cold sores, infections, or who’s recently had dental procedures, illness, or vaccinations should wait until fully recovered. We’ll talk through your medical history during your consult.
